The Dart inshore lifeboat was called at the request of the Coastguard after they had received a 999 call reporting cries for help coming from the river in the vicinity of the Noss Marina. A couple had been returning in their dory to their boat moored off Higher Noss Creek. Close to their boat the skipper fell in and the uncontrolled boat with his wife and dog on board continued up the river in the dark. The skipper was recovered by another yachtsman moored nearby, Jamie Hudson Bond, who searched for him in his tender and found him clinging to the bow rope of the skipper's yacht. By that time he had been in the 7 degree C. water for twenty minutes and was very cold. He took him to the Noss Marina where he was assessed by an ambulance crew and transferred to Torbay Hospital. The dory, with his wife on board, eventually hit the bank on the Kingswear side further upstream of the incident where she and the dog were located by the lifeboat crew and taken to the Noss Marina.
